Solution

The correct option is A Cl3CCOOH
Stronger acid has lower pKa value and strong acids are those which have weaker (stable) conjugate base.
In all the options given, stability of conjugate base are decided by the number of attached Cl group at the α carbon.
Since Cl is electronegative atom ann it stabilise the charge by I effect. Hence more the Cl atom, more is the stabilisation.

Cl3CCOOH is the strongest acid having lowest pK value.
